The DOT Permitting Coordinator supports the Transmission Line Services (TLS) team by assisting with the preparation submission and tracking of permits required for transmission and fiber projects. This role ensures compliance with state county and municipal regulations while coordinating with internal teams and external agencies to facilitate timely approvals.
Key Responsibilities
Assist in preparing reviewing and submitting permits to ALDOT as well as city and county agencies
Track permit applications and provide status updates to internal stakeholders
Coordinate with ALDOT districts local government agencies and internal teams to resolve permitting issues
Ensure all permitting activities comply with ALDOT Utility Manual and Permit Manual guidelines
Support oversized load route reviews within APCO service areas
Assist in reviewing Temporary Traffic Control (TTC) plans in accordance with MUTCD Part 6 standards
Maintain accurate records of permitting documentation and communications
